Поделиться через


Оператор \=

Делит значение переменной или свойства на значение выражения и присваивает целочисленный результат переменной или свойству.

variableorproperty \= expression

Части

  • variableorproperty
    Обязательный.Любая числовая переменная или свойство.

  • expression
    Обязательный.Произвольное числовое выражение.

Заметки

Элемент с левой стороны оператора \= может быть простой скалярной переменной, свойством или элементом массива.Переменная или свойство не могут быть ReadOnly (Visual Basic).

Оператор \= делит значения переменной или свойство в своем остается значением для права и присвоить его результат переменной или свойства целого числа в его влево

Дополнительные сведения о целочисленном делении см. в разделе Оператор \ (Visual Basic).

Перегрузка

Оператор \ может быть перегружен; это означает, что класс или структура может переопределить его поведение, если операнд имеет тип соответствующего класса или структуры.Перегрузка оператора \ влияет на тип выполнения оператора \=.Если в коде используется оператор \= для класса или структуры, перегружающей \, убедитесь, что его переопределенное выполнение понятно.Дополнительные сведения см. в разделе Процедуры операторов (Visual Basic).

Пример

В следующем примере оператор \= используется для деления значения одной переменной типа Integer на значение другой переменной и присваивания целочисленного результата первой переменной.

Dim var1 As Integer = 10
Dim var2 As Integer = 3
var1 \= var2
' The value of var1 is now 3.

См. также

Ссылки

Оператор \ (Visual Basic)

Оператор /= (Visual Basic)

Операторы присваивания (Visual Basic)

Арифметические операторы (Visual Basic)

Порядок применения операторов в Visual Basic

Список операторов, сгруппированных по функциональному назначению (Visual Basic)

Другие ресурсы

Операторы в Visual Basic